Job Description

Responsible for managing plant continuous improvement initiatives to reduce operating costs and improve manufacturing efficiencies. Duties include managing lean projects, Kaizen events, 5S activities, 3P events, Six Sigma projects and tracking CI reductions. Reports to the General Manager and has 3‑5 direct reports.

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Champion the Master Brand Business System (MBS) strategy and provide hands‑on support and any necessary training during implementation.
  • Supervise and develop Continuous Improvement team.
  • Coach and lead Continuous Improvement teams with strategic planning, goal setting, lean manufacturing, cost reduction documentation, and problem‑solving principles.
  • Lead and facilitate strategic initiatives, Kaizen workshops, and other Lean activities, including:
    Six Sigma projects, Kaizen events, 3P events, 5S activities, continuous improvement initiatives, lean manufacturing efforts, R&A and scrap reduction, and process and quality improvements.
  • Partner with the General Manager on strategic planning and goal setting.
  • Deliver plant-wide and associate‑level training in Lean and Continuous Improvement methodologies.
  • Follow up with operations team to ensure successful implementation of future‑state plans.
  • Support safety, quality, delivery, and cost (SQDC) initiatives through clearly defined, actionable plans.
  • Champion safety through visible leadership, site‑specific safety plans, and targeted Master Brand initiatives.
  • Identify and implement new technology, equipment, systems, and process improvements to enhance Master Brand’s manufacturing platform and maximize return on investment.
  • Perform miscellaneous duties and projects as assigned and required.
